CreatePartition
CreatePartition
指定要在硬盘上创建的单个分区。
如果要将 Windows 安装到空白硬盘,则必须使用 CreatePartition
和 ModifyPartition 在磁盘上创建和格式化分区。 还必须将值添加到 InstallTo 或 InstallToAvailablePartition 以指定安装 Windows 的位置。
子元素
设置 | 说明 |
---|---|
延长 | 指定是否扩展分区以填充磁盘。 |
Order | 指定多个分区的创建顺序。 |
大小 | 指定要创建的分区的大小(以兆字节为单位)。 |
类型 | 指定要创建的分区的类型。 例如,可以指定主要分区类型或扩展分区类型。 |
有效配置阶段
windowsPE
父层次结构
Microsoft-Windows-Setup | DiskConfiguration | Disk | CreatePartitions | CreatePartition
应用于
有关此组件支持的 Windows 版本和体系结构的列表,请参阅 Microsoft-Windows-Setup。
XML 示例
DiskConfiguration
设置的以下 XML 输出显示了如何创建驱动器分区。
<DiskConfiguration>
<Disk wcm:action="add">
<DiskID>0</DiskID>
<WillWipeDisk>true</WillWipeDisk>
<CreatePartitions>
<!-- System partition -->
<CreatePartition wcm:action="add">
<Order>1</Order>
<Type>Primary</Type>
<Size>300</Size>
</CreatePartition>
<!-- Windows partition -->
<CreatePartition wcm:action="add">
<Order>2</Order>
<Type>Primary</Type>
<Extend>true</Extend>
</CreatePartition>
</CreatePartitions>
<ModifyPartitions>
<!-- System partition -->
<ModifyPartition wcm:action="add">
<Order>1</Order>
<PartitionID>1</PartitionID>
<Label>System</Label>
<Format>NTFS</Format>
<Active>true</Active>
</ModifyPartition>
<!-- Windows partition -->
<ModifyPartition wcm:action="add">
<Order>2</Order>
<PartitionID>2</PartitionID>
<Label>Windows</Label>
<Letter>C</Letter>
<Format>NTFS</Format>
</ModifyPartition>
</ModifyPartitions>
</Disk>
<WillShowUI>OnError</WillShowUI>
</DiskConfiguration>
<ImageInstall>
<OSImage>
<InstallTo>
<DiskID>0</DiskID>
<PartitionID>2</PartitionID>
</InstallTo>
</OSImage>
</ImageInstall>
有关完整的 XML 示例和推荐的分区配置,请参阅如何配置基于 UEFI/GPT 的硬盘分区或如何配置基于 BIOS/MBR 的硬盘分区。